SSSD error: Mismatch between input domain name [EXAMPLE] and parsed domain name [example.com]

Solution Verified - Updated -

Issue

  • SSSD error message Mismatch between input domain name [EXAMPLE] and parsed domain name [example.com] is recorded:

    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[get_client_cred] (0x4000): Client [0x555c4da89840][23] creds: euid[0] egid[0] pid[10347] cmd_line['sss_ssh_authorizedkeys'].
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[setup_client_idle_timer] (0x4000): Idle timer re-set for client [0x555c4da89840][23]
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[accept_fd_handler] (0x0400): Client [CID #1][cmd sss_ssh_authorizedkeys][0x555c4da89840][23] connected!
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[sss_cmd_get_version] (0x0200): Received client version [0].
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[sss_cmd_get_version] (0x0200): Offered version [0].
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[ssh_protocol_parse_request] (0x0400): Requested domain [EXAMPLE]
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[ssh_cmd_get_user_pubkeys] (0x0400): Requesting SSH user public keys for [administrator@example.com] from [EXAMPLE]
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[cache_req_set_plugin] (0x2000): CR #0: Setting "User by name" plugin
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[cache_req_send] (0x0400): CR #0: REQ_TRACE: New request [CID #1] 'User by name'
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[cache_req_process_input] (0x0400): CR #0: Parsing input name [administrator@example.com]
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[sss_domain_get_state] (0x1000): Domain implicit_files is Active
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[sss_domain_get_state] (0x1000): Domain example.com is Active
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[sss_parse_name_for_domains] (0x0200): name 'administrator@example.com' matched expression for domain 'example.com', user is administrator
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[cache_req_input_parsed] (0x0020): Mismatch between input domain name [EXAMPLE] and parsed domain name [example.com]
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[ssh_protocol_done] (0x4000): Sending reply: error [1432158243]: Cannot parse input
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[client_recv] (0x0200): Client disconnected!
    (2021-12-09 12:16:01): [ssh] [client_close_fn] (0x2000): Terminated client [0x555c4da89840][23]
    

Environment

  • Red Hat Enterprise Linux 8.5 and newer
    • sssd
